Katie's, 01/12/13

It was a day of suprises.
It was supposed to be a warm morning, and it wasn't bad (42F at 6AM), but it started out very foggy, and did not warm up at all during the morning. When I arrived at Katie's at 6:15AM, only one car was already there - Mark Franke and his son Joseph had arrived before me in their Esprit.

The questionable weather situation caused people to dribble into Katie's all morning long. I saw several cars arriving, just as I left at 9:30AM.

My personal favorite surprise was Steve driving his rare Lotus Omega. Built in 1991, it was the fastest production 4-door in the world for several years.
